Samsung Display 110″ Ultra HDTV Before CES 2014

This years CES is just days away and with all the major tech companies in the world preparing to promote their newest tech at the show in Las Vegas, you can bet the next few days will be crammed with teasers and announcements. Few announcements come bigger than this one, mostly because this is now the biggest consumer product that Samsung produce.

Due to be on display at CES 2014, Samsung’s 110″ Ultra HDTV will be going on sale this Monday. This version will be limited to China, Middle East and some parts of Europe, but Samsung have said that they will make it available in more regions in another 9 weeks time.

Don’t go shaking down your penny jar just yet though, this TV is freaking huge! Not only will you need a pretty big room to house this screen, you’ll also need some seriously big numbers in your bank account. The 85″ model that was the flaghship Samsung screen at CES 2013 will still set you back a whopping $40,000 (£25,000), this one is bigger and better in every way possible, so you can bet that while Samsung haven’t revealed the price, it will be skyward of £25,000, perhaps even about £40,000.
